Innovating Beyond Tradition: The Evolution of Competitive Ice Fishing and Its Media Representation

Ice fishing, long regarded as a solitary and contemplative winter pastime, has experienced a remarkable transformation in recent years. Once confined to local lakes and regional tournaments, the sport now intersects with burgeoning media phenomena, blending traditional angling with high-stakes entertainment. Central to this evolution is the emergence of narrative-driven, competitive formats that appeal to a broader audience, positioning themselves as credible showcases of skill, strategy, and resilience.

The Changing Landscape of Ice Fishing: From Solitary Pursuit to Competitive Sport

Historically, ice fishing was an activity rooted in community, patience, and environmental harmony. Fishermen would seek solitary moments on frozen lakes, relying on intuition and experience to strike their catch. However, as environmental conditions and recreational demand evolved, so did the organizational structures surrounding ice fishing. Regional tournaments and community events laid the groundwork for a more competitive framework, emphasizing technique, equipment, and adaptability.

Today, with increasing interest in outdoor adventure sports and the rise of digital media, ice fishing has transcended its traditional boundaries. Athletes now compete in highly organized tournaments that often feature live broadcasts, commentary, and significant prize money — all elements reminiscent of mainstream sporting events. This evolution has led to increased professionalism and specialization within the sport, supported by data-driven analysis and technological innovations such as underwater cameras, sonar, and custom gear.

The Role of Digital Communities and Data Analytics

Digital platforms have fostered vibrant communities of ice fishermen and enthusiasts who exchange strategies, equipment reviews, and environmental observations. This collective knowledge-sharing is complemented by the advent of data analytics, allowing competitors to optimize their techniques based on weather patterns, fish behavior, and historical tournament results.
